This place is living proof that you don't have to be fancy to deliver a 5 star experience. Came at lunch on a Friday, was sat promptly, water, menu, & place setting shortly thereafter, and food was out within 10 mins of ordering - piping hot, fresh, and to order. Prices are fair, server Bree was attentive without being annoying, and easy parking. If I lived here, would definitely be back! Bonus points for the cute little train that runs around the track

I want to love this location because it's the most convenient one to get to for me. I've been here a few times for dining in but taking out during busy times is ROUGH. Taking out experience: I know Friday night is a staple for pizza takeout. I was really in no rush especially since the website said it was about a 45 min wait. I placed my order went about 1hr later to pick it up, when I checked in the cashier told me they were running 15-30 min behind. There seemed to be a bit of drama with someone moving orders ahead of others on top of the delays. They were busy for dine in and takeout so it was a bit of a mess. I ended up waiting maybe an extra 20 mins for my order. I just wish the online estimate was a bit better as there's not much waiting space and not idea to keep leaving and coming back to check. Dining in experience: For the most part dining in has been fine. It's usually almost always decently busy. Kind of loud always. The restaurant is clean. The food in general: I always do byo pizza - just plain cheese with jalapenos & banana peppers. The toppings are a bit pricey but the same price for any size pizza you order almost. I love the thin crust. We usually almost always get the deep dish cookie dessert as well - so good. Staff are usually nice and attentive. They have a smaller parking lot but almost always never had issues with parking.

5 stars for the pizza and would definitely come back for it. I don't recommend ordering a salad to-go. A friend moved to Bloomington so I swung by Broadway to bring over dinner and to help unpack. Inside is old-school. All wood, a cute train that moves around the whole restaurant. A throwback to a 90s-esque family pizza joint. I could imagine my whole t-ball team coming here after a game. My order was ready on time and the pizza was hot and fresh. The pizza was actually the best pizza I've had in the twin cities. I regretted ordering the salad because it all got composted... the lettuce was brown and everything was wilted and looked like the veggies had been cut up and stored/were sitting out for a while. The pizza is thin crust. I always order extra sauce and light cheese. The pizza sauce was very good. And they were generous with the toppings. It was all so affordable. Just a solid pizza joint!

Do they deliver to great Wolf lodge?

Yes. We had them deliver to us at Great Wolf. It was pretty slick. They call the room when they get there and you meet them in the lobby. Best delivery pizza option. Very good pizza.
